titleOfInvention | Synthetic cellular membrane chemical ionophore delivery system comprising hexa-aqua ligand compositions |
abstract | Synthetic ionophores for the active carry and transport of free ions across biological membranes in vivo , comprising coordination complexes of molecules with polarized hexa-aqua and/or tetra-aqua systems of free ionic metals and ionic salts as the ionophores, useful in transporting pharmaceutical, nutrient, and personal healthcare compounds. Also described are methods of their administration, methods of their synthesis and manufacture, and the ionophore products of such synthesis and manufacturing methods. |
